Originally Posted by Atticus
Hi guys

Off topic but very urgent - need print a few things but my printer wont install!! We fly off on Monday so need it to work before then!!

Will try to keep it short but basically when computer went bellyup restored computer - but never re-connected the printer - during this time we got broadband speedtouch with wanadoo (not sure if this is entirely relevant!) - anyway when following instructions (down to a t!!) when it comes to locating the usb port there is nothing - went on hp's website (Deskjet 880c) to follow any troubleshooting advice and when I went into the win.ini bit and clicked ports, no usb showing up just lp1-3 etc and COM (no longer have the parallel cables! bugger!!) - so now what do I do? does anyone have any ideas as Im very desperate.

thanks in advance

atticus
You need to install the software from the CD that came with the printer before you plug the printer in. That CD will install the USB virtual port and then Windows will automatically detect the printer.
